Factors Affecting Cravings

To manage food cravings effectively, focus on identifying triggers that lead to overeating. Cravings triggers can be caused by various factors such as stress, emotions, or even certain environmental cues. Understanding these triggers is essential in learning how to manage and eventually overcome them. Additionally, appetite regulation plays a significant role in managing food cravings. Ensuring that you maintain a balanced diet, eat regular meals, and stay hydrated can help regulate your appetite and reduce the intensity of cravings. It's also important to be mindful of portion sizes and to avoid skipping meals, as this can lead to intense hunger and increased likelihood of giving in to cravings. By addressing these factors, you can better manage your food cravings and work towards maintaining a healthier relationship with food.

Strategies for Managing

Identify your triggers and develop personalized strategies for managing food cravings to effectively curb overeating. Start by practicing portion control to avoid overindulging. Use smaller plates, bowls, and utensils to trick your brain into feeling satisfied with smaller portions. Be mindful of serving sizes and avoid eating directly from the package. Additionally, practice emotional regulation to avoid using food as a coping mechanism. Find alternative activities such as going for a walk, practicing deep breathing, or engaging in a hobby to distract yourself from cravings. When experiencing emotional distress, seek support from friends, family, or a therapist instead of turning to food. By implementing these strategies, you can gain control over your cravings and reduce overeating tendencies.
